Lead Peer Educators Bellevue College

Peer Educators serve as a mentor to support and encourage new first year students in their adjustment to college life-style and the expectations of college in general. Through one-on-one interactions and group meetings, Peer Educators are knowledgeable guides for new students, a thoughtful facilitator who provides access to people and resources, ultimately becoming a role model and a successful advocate.

Through our program and networks we focus on student advocacy, community engagement, and peer-to-peer mentorship.

Mission

  • Our mission is to help Bellevue College students access and navigate campus resources and to achieve their academic/career goals.

Vision

  • Our vision is to create a diverse, student-centered program to build collaborations with campus programs, solve problems through community engagement strategies, and improve educational quality for Bellevue College students.
